Valencia full-back Aly Cissokho emerges as a reported transfer target for Premier League side Sunderland.

Sunderland manager Paolo Di Canio has reportedly identified Aly Cissokho to fill his team's left-back void.

Danny Rose played in that position for the majority of last season, but he has now returned to his parent club Tottenham Hotspur.

Earlier this summer Di Canio tried to sign Argentine full-back Lucas Orban, but that deal failed to materialise.

As a result, the Black Cats have turned their attention to 25-year-old Cissokho, according to the Sunderland Echo.

However, the report added that Liverpool are likely to challenge Sunderland for the French international's signature.
